Excel查找替换通配符,星号问号批量修改格式

反常识型开头:在Excel中,查找替换功能比想象中更灵活,通配符能让操作事半功倍。

星号(*)和问号(?)是常用的通配符。星号代表任意多个字符,问号代表任意单个字符。比如,查找"abc*"能找到所有以"abc"开头的文本,"*cde"能找到所有以"cde"结尾的文本。问号则更精确,"a?c"只能匹配"aac"、"abc"等。

通配符的典型应用场景

通配符在处理不规范数据时特别有用。假设一列地址数据中,城市名称前都有"城市:"前缀,可以用"城市:*"快速定位所有城市名,然后替换"*"为空字符串实现标准化。

问号则适合修正固定长度但字符有错的文本。比如"姓?名"能匹配"张三"、"李四"等,如果需要修正"王?芳"中的问号,直接替换为正确字符即可。

注意:通配符查找时需要勾选"选项"里的"使用通配符"。替换时,通配符前加波浪号(~)可以匹配特殊字符本身,比如~*匹配星号。

批量修改格式的进阶技巧

通配符常与格式设置结合。比如,给一列数据中所有包含"报告"的单元格设置红色字体,可以先使用"报告*"查找,然后右键选择"设置单元格格式",勾选条件格式。

处理换行符时,通配符也能派上用场。Excel默认不显示换行符,但可以通过查找替换实现可见化。先按Ctrl+H,查找内容输入"^(任意字符)"(左上角三角符号代表换行符),替换为"换行符可见"等标记文本。

批量修改日期格式时,假设"2023年1月2日"和"01/02/2023"混在一列,可以用"2023*"查找所有完整日期,统一替换为标准格式。

常见误区与注意事项

误区:认为通配符只能用于文本。实际上,数字和公式中也能使用,但需要确保查找范围包含数值或公式。

技巧:替换操作前备份数据。特别是使用通配符进行全局替换时,建议先复制列到新工作表操作,避免误改。

细节:星号和问号的作用域有差异。星号更宽泛,适合模糊匹配;问号更严格,适合精确定位单个字符差异。

例子:处理身份证号时,如果需要隐藏最后一位,可以用"*"替换为"****",但如果是带字母的身份证号,通配符可能失效。

最后一条具体信息:把香蕉和苹果分开放,能减缓成熟。

Excel查找替换通配符,星号问号批量修改格式(图1)

Excel查找替换通配符,星号问号批量修改格式(图2)

Excel查找替换通配符,星号问号批量修改格式(图3)

相关推荐